摘要:针对火铺煤矿综采工作面煤层松软破碎,易发生煤壁片帮、冒顶的情况,以21170综采工作面为工程背景,运用理论分析、现场监测等方法,研究了工作面基本顶的变形及破断规律,得到了火铺煤矿21170工作面的矿压显现规律。研究结果表明,该工作面基本顶周期来压步距为13.7 m,中部支架平均循环末阻力大于上部、下部支架阻力,应加强工作面运输、回风巷的管理。研究可为该矿17号煤层后续高效回采工作提供有益参考。
In view of the situation that the coal seam is soft and broken,and the coal wall is easy to collapse and roof collapse,taking No.21170 fully-mechanized mining face as the engineering background,the deformation and breaking laws of the basic roof of the working face are studied by using theoretical analysis,field monitoring and other methods,and the ore pressure manifestation laws are obtained.The research results show that the average weighting interval of the basic roof cycle is 13.7 m,the average end of cycle resistance of the middle support is greater than that of the upper and lower support,and the management of the working face transportation and return airway should be strengthened.The research can provide useful reference for the subsequent efficient mining of the No.17 coal seam in the mine.
